MULTIFRACTALITY OF RADON CONCENTRATION FLUCTUATION IN EARTHQUAKE RELATED SIGNAL

摘要

Radon anomaly acts as a precursor to seismic events. Hence the fluctuation pattern of time series of radon bears a lot of significance. Multifractal detrended fluctuation analysis (MFDFA) has been applied successfully in past to various geo-electrical signals. The time series of earthquake related radon signal of duration three years (November 2005-November 2008) obtained from our experiment performed at Kolkata, India was analyzed in the framework of MFDFA. The study revealed that the fluctuation of radon concentration is multifractal in nature.
